For more than 40 years, Salerno’s Italian Restaurant has been serving North Texas with the same family recipes, warm hospitality, and commitment to quality that inspired its founding in 1985. Built on generations of Italian tradition, Salerno’s was created with a simple mission: to treat every guest like family while serving authentic Italian dishes made from scratch using the freshest ingredients. Although Dallas is a foodie paradise, Salerno's Italian restaurant is strategically located in Highland Village, so that we can be involved civically and charitably in the local community. The restaurant concept consists of:
- Scratch made family recipes using the freshest ingredients
- Quick, friendly service in a full-service atmosphere
- Generous portions at low prices
